Job Description:
We are seeking a dynamic and visionary School Principal to lead our educational community towards excellence. The School Principal will serve as the educational leader, responsible for the overall management and administration of the school. This individual will inspire and motivate both students and staff to achieve their fullest potential, uphold high academic standards, and foster a positive and inclusive learning environment.
Responsibilities:
Develop and articulate a clear vision for academic success aligned with the school's mission and values.
Implement innovative educational programs and strategies to enhance student learning outcomes.
Foster a culture of continuous improvement and professional development among staff.
Oversee day-to-day operations of the school, including scheduling, budgeting, and resource allocation.
Ensure compliance with all local, state, and federal regulations related to education.
Maintain effective communication with stakeholders, including parents, teachers, and community members.
Create a safe, supportive, and nurturing environment conducive to student success.
Implement and enforce school policies and procedures to maintain discipline and promote positive behavior.
Conduct regular evaluations of teaching staff to assess performance and provide feedback for improvement.
Support professional growth through mentoring, coaching, and professional development opportunities.
Foster a collaborative and collegial work environment that values teamwork and shared accountability.
Cultivate positive relationships with parents, guardians, and community members to support student success.
Qualifications:
Degree in Education.
Valid certification or license as a School Principal/Administrator.
Strong understanding of educational best practices, curriculum development, and assessment strategies.
Excellent communication, interpersonal, and leadership skills.
Ability to inspire and motivate students, staff, and stakeholders towards a shared vision of academic excellence.
Commitment to diversity, equity, and inclusion in education.
